As it is a balanced allocation mutual fund the taxation is as follows:If the fund is equity oriented i.e. asset allocation of more than 65% in equity instruments:For short term (less than a year) capital gains will be taxed at 20%For long term (more than 1 year) capital gains will be taxed at 12.5% without indexation benefitLong term gains up to Rs 1 lakh are exempt from taxation (more than 12 months).
This investment strategy aims to achieve a blend of capital appreciation and income generation by maintaining a balanced exposure to equity and debt instruments, with a minimum of 25% in each, while utilizing up to 25% in short derivative positions to enhance returns and manage risk.
